We had one years ago that the boss bought after the barrel burst. A company swapped it out and we took it. He sold it to someone as a used chiller so we jacked it up about 2 foot at one end and drilled holes in the condenser u-bends and drained the water out. Changed the evap and compressors of course but it took 6 pumps all running 24 hours a day over a week to dry it out.
